How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Branford?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Branford Studio Apartments | $1,050 | $940 | $1,310 |
Branford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,572 | $900 | $2,751 |
Branford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,781 | $1,100 | $3,622 |
Branford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,958 | $574 | $6,723 |
Branford 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,162 | $494 | $2,507 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
